Consent
Together with Planning Application, in conservation areas, is necessary
to apply for consent. This sort of application comes together with Planning
Applications even if different officers take the decision.
Unfortunately conservation area consents drives a design restriction that
frequently creates technical, cost, and sustainability issues of the project.

building without or with minimum internal space reduction. Every case must be taken under consideration in order to achieve the energy usage is reduced very significantly from 50% to 90%. Listed Building
Works to the interior or exterior of a listed building must be authorised
through granting listed building consent. Should be considered that it
is a criminal offence to carry out work which needs listed building consent
without obtaining it beforehand.
The listed buildings are classified as following: grade I and grade II.
If you are not sure if your property is listed you can have further information
from the English Heritage or the Secretary of state for Culture, Media
and Sport.
